Output de8ef4bc897ed634fd6da2ce6eea39eda2ba2f6e89b505b04f3e102273398ea5:3

value
68694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c98e20c60a94e58c25f158dd2675150d0e60b3d OP_EQUAL
address
34JDzQrn5QKskAEgE53i1ZzLukcoDgzYX6
transaction
de8ef4bc897ed634fd6da2ce6eea39eda2ba2f6e89b505b04f3e102273398ea5
spent
true